Output f201277593387c2f36c8bd00302e89d6f6ae4e5948f3d3ce43c53e8e9020b47d:2

value
26577861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2c1c10d7d63a421a26a7735a98bfeac81052af1 OP_EQUAL
address
MW2js8CJh5STJEoa1WQTsfv74TtieNA81V
transaction
f201277593387c2f36c8bd00302e89d6f6ae4e5948f3d3ce43c53e8e9020b47d
spent
true